Service Care Solutions is seeking a motivated Probation Officer to work full-time across HMP Forest Bank and HMP Hindley. This role involves managing a caseload of offenders, completing high-quality OASys assessments, and undertaking public protection checks. The ideal candidate will have strong communication skills and experience in offender management.

The probation officer will contribute to rehabilitation efforts while ensuring public safety and preparing offenders for release.
